What are "NDBs" in aviation navigation?

Explanation:
Non-Directional Beacons, or NDBs, are radio beacons used in aviation navigation. They operate by transmitting radio waves in all directions, hence the term "non-directional." Pilots use NDBs as reference points during flight; aircraft are equipped with ADF (Automatic Direction Finder) systems to accurately navigate towards these beacons. This allows pilots to determine their bearing relative to the NDB and can assist in a variety of navigation tasks, including approaches and holding patterns. The significance of NDBs lies in their ability to provide navigation guidance regardless of the aircraft's orientation to the beacon. This is crucial in situations where visibility is poor or during night flying, making NDBs an invaluable asset for ensuring safety and accuracy in navigation.
